Why do psychologists use the scientific method? - ✔✔The scientific method consists of
the orderly, systematic procedures researchers follow as they identify a research
problem, design a study to investigate the problem, collect and analyze data, draw
conclusions, and communicate their findings. Psychologists use it because it is the most
objective method known for obtaining dependable knowledge.
psychology - ✔✔The science of behavior and mental processes. That seeks to describe
and explain aspects of human thought feelings, perceptions and actions.

hypothesis - ✔✔A testable prediction about the conditions under which a particular
behavior or mental process may occur
replication - ✔✔The process of repeating a study to verify research findings.
What are the goals of psychology? - ✔✔The four goals of psychology are to describe,
explain, predict, and influence behavior and mental processes.
basic research - ✔✔Research conducted to seek new knowledge and to explore and
advance general scientific understanding. The purpose of basic research is to seek new
knowledge and to expand general scientific understanding.
applied research - ✔✔Research conducted specifically to solve practical problems and
improve the quality of life. Applied research explores the application of psychological
principles to practical problems and everyday life.
